The traditional monarch’s inauguration ceremony, which held in Ile
Ife, Osun State, was witnessed by traditional rulers as well as
political and tribal leaders.
“As we celebrate and experience the pump and pageantry of the cult of
Ooni and the expression in songs and dance of the ancient folklore of
the proud people of this cradle of Yoruba civilization, we are reminded
of the weightier matter of the great responsibility that has to be on
His Royal Majesty, the new Ooni,” Professor Osinbajo said.
Past and present governors of Osun, Oyo, Ogun, Lagos; leaders of the
APC, captains of industries, traditional rulers from the southwest
states, the Sultan of Sokoto, Dein of Agbor and the Obong of Calabar
amongst others were not left out of the ceremony.
The Osun State Governor, Rauf Aregbesola, said, “Kingship appointment
is not an ordinary one and by our culture and tradition, the King rules
on behalf of the gods.
“He is therefore accountable not just to men but also to the gods as
well, for good governance and sustenance of the legacies of the past 50
kings before him.”
Other dignitaries also took turns to deliver their goodwill messages
laden with calls for peace, unity and responsibility for the youths, and
the Ooni himself in his speech assured well-wishers that he was aware
of the responsibilities bestowed on him.
“If we have leadership there will be followership, the two go hand in
hand. You cannot be king over animals nor plants, it has to be human
beings,” he said.
